Debutify is a Shopify theme designed for merchants who want a straightforward storefront setup with built-in conversion tooling. It supports Online Store 2.0, section-based layouts, global style controls, and mobile-first rendering. The theme emphasizes performance and accessibility while offering practical components such as sticky add-to-cart, announcement bars, trust elements, variant swatches, product tabs, and cart drawer options. An optional suite of add-ons extends the theme for common growth workflows: upsell and cross-sell prompts, countdown and scarcity widgets, personalization, newsletter and popup capture, and post-purchase offers. The theme integrates with popular review and analytics apps and follows Shopifyโs native checkout and reporting, making it easier to evaluate changes using standard metrics (CVR, AOV, bounce, and page speed). Typical use cases include launching a new store with minimal custom code, migrating from a heavy app stack to reduce bloat, and running iterative design tests on product and collection templates. Documentation and presets aim to shorten time-to-publish while keeping room for custom CSS or app integrations.
